Effective communication is the foundation for any healthy relationship, be it personal or professional. Effective communication is the key to building connections, resolving conflicts, managing emotions, and understanding different points of view. It’s essential to establish and maintain a relationship built upon trust, respect, and mutual understanding. In this blog, we will explore the importance of communication in building healthy relationships and how effective communication can transform our lives.

Communicating effectively in relationships helps to build an emotional bond that goes beyond mere physical attraction. When you take the time to listen to your partner, respond with empathy, and express yourself clearly and honestly, it leads to emotional intimacy and a deeper understanding of one another. This creates a sense of security and trust in the relationship that can withstand any obstacles that may arise.

It’s important to note that communication is a two-way street. It’s not just about expressing how you feel but also about listening to what your partner has to say. Effective communication involves actively listening to your partner’s thoughts, feelings, and needs, and responding with compassion and empathy. This shows your partner that you care about their point of view and their feelings, which strengthens your relationship.

In addition to building emotional intimacy, effective communication can help to resolve conflicts. In any relationship, misunderstandings can arise, leading to disagreements or even arguments. However, effective communication skills can help to prevent these conflicts from escalating. By actively listening to your partner’s perspective, acknowledging their feelings, and responding with a desire to find a mutually beneficial solution, you can avoid confrontations and unnecessary tension in your relationship.

Another important aspect of effective communication is the ability to manage emotions. All relationships come with emotional ups and downs, ranging from happiness and joy to sadness and frustration. Healthy communication involves expressing these emotions openly and handling them in a constructive manner. Suppressing negative emotions can lead to resentment and negative thoughts, which can quickly damage a relationship. Instead, it’s essential to communicate your emotions honestly and respectfully, allowing for a healthy exchange of thoughts and feelings that can help to strengthen the relationship.

In conclusion, communication is the key to building healthy and successful relationships. By expressing yourself respectfully, listening actively, and managing emotions constructively, you can build emotional intimacy, trust, and understanding in your relationship. Effective communication can help to prevent misunderstandings, resolve conflicts, and create a stronger emotional connection with your partner. Remember that communication is a two-way street, and it’s essential to establish open and honest communication channels that allow for mutual respect and understanding. By prioritizing communication in your relationships, you can create a healthier and happier life for yourself and your loved ones.
